大数据学习之路—环境配置——IP设置(虚拟机修改Ip的内在原因及实现)
一、IP原理
关于IP我的理解,
(1)主要去理解IP地址的作用,IP地址包括网络相关部分和主机的相关部分。即:用一段特殊的数据,来标识网络特征和主机的特征。
至于具体的技术实现,日后可以慢慢体会和了解。
IP的基本原理可以参考:https://www.cnblogs.com/yinzhengjie/p/6649245.html
(2)静态IP与动态IP的区别
这两者的理解可以参考下面这句话,我觉得说的比较清楚。
动态获取,优点是上级下发,IP地址、子网掩码、网关、dns服务器都是上级认为的正确可用配置,IP地址不重复。缺点是必须要一个DHCP服务器进行下发,交换机组网时出现获取不到IP地址状况,IP地址回收机制导致下发IP属于随机地址,服务器无法得到固定IP导致其它设备无法访问服务器。适合局域网内无特殊设备统一连接外部网络。
静态IP,优点是每个设备IP地址不变,可任意访问每个已知设备。缺点是新加入网络无法快速设置IP地址、子网掩码、网关、dns服务器等参数,出现地址重复、不在同一局域网等现象导致无法连接网络问题。适合每个设备都有专门功能,不会随时加入新设备的情况。静态IP能通过IP地址远程访问对应的电脑。
总的来说,两者都可以正常联网,不过需要正常配置。值得注意的一点是校园网好像不适合设置为静态IP。
两者的具体区别可参考网址:https://www.zhihu.com/question/22134745
二、虚拟机修改IP的原因
每次学习到虚拟机环境配置时,一开始总会让你在linux系统上修改ip;至于其中的背后的原因未曾提及。在查看相关资料后总结如下:
(1)最简单,最直接的原因就是改为固定ip后,方便xshell链接,简化后续操作。
(2)静态IP能通过IP地址远程访问对应的电脑。
(3)满足有多台虚拟机之间互联的需求
三、修改IP的方法
关于linux环境下修改Ip的方法,可以参考:
值得注意的是:
(1)虚拟机的ip地址和主机的ip的地址不冲突,可以简单理解为是两个不同的东西。所以不管怎么修改虚拟机的ip地址不会影响到主机的ip地址。
(2)在Windows系统中修改的IP地址是VMnet8的IP地址,而VMnet8表示的是虚拟网卡的IP地址,所以和主机的IP地址不冲突。
(3)修改的ip中,第三个部分不能轻易填 1 2或 255;如***.***.1.***这样修改会出问题。
这里可以参考连接:https://blog.csdn.net/a1004117090/article/details/101601408
大数据学习之路—环境配置——IP设置(虚拟机修改Ip的内在原因及实现)的更多相关文章
- 大数据学习之路——环境配置(2)——mysql 在linux 系统上安装配置
1.安装参考网址: https://blog.csdn.net/IronWring_Fly/article/details/103637801 设置新秘密: mysqladmin -u root ...
- 大数据学习之路之ambari配置(二)
按照网上的教程配置,发现配置到hadoop虚拟机内存就开始不够了,心累
- 大数据学习之路又之从小白到用sqoop导出数据
写这篇文章的目的是总结自己学习大数据的经验,以为自己走了很多弯路,从迷茫到清晰,真的花费了很多时间,希望这篇文章能帮助到后面学习的人. 一.配置思路 安装linux虚拟机--->创建三台虚拟机- ...
- 大数据学习之路(1)Hadoop生态体系结构
Hadoop的核心是HDFS和MapReduce,hadoop2.0还包括YARN. Hadoop1.x的生态系统: Hadoop2.x引入YARN: HDFS(Hadoop分布式文件系统)源自于Go ...
- 大数据学习之路之Hadoop
Hadoop介绍 一.简介 Hadoop是一个开源的分布式计算平台,用于存储大数据,并使用MapReduce来处理.Hadoop擅长于存储各种格式的庞大的数据,任意的格式甚至非结构化的处理.两个核心: ...
- 大数据学习之路------借助HDP SANDBOX开始学习
一开始... 一开始知道大数据这个概念的时候,只是感觉很高大上,引起了我的兴趣.当时也不知道,这个东西是做什么的,有什么用,当然现在看来也是很模糊的样子,但是的确比一开始强了不少. 所以学习的过程可能 ...
- 大数据学习之路之HBASE
Hadoop之HBASE 一.HBASE简介 HBase是一个开源的.分布式的,多版本的,面向列的,半结构化的NoSql数据库,提供高性能的随机读写结构化数据的能力.它可以直接使用本地文件系统,也可以 ...
- 大数据学习之路之ambari配置(四)
试了很多遍,内存还是不够,电脑不太行的,不建议用ambari!!! 放弃了
- 大数据学习之路之ambari配置(三)
添加了虚拟机内存空间 重装ambari
随机推荐
- Kubernetes Secrets
Secrets 背景信息 Kubernetes版本 [09:08:04 yhf@test ~]$ kubectl version Client Version: version.Info{Major: ...
- 诸葛亮的锦囊妙计竟然是大名鼎鼎的Java设计模式:策略模式
目录 应用场景 简单实现例子 改进代码 策略模式 定义 意图 主要解决问题 何时使用 优缺点 诸葛亮的锦囊妙计 应用场景 京东.天猫双十一,情人节商品大促销,各种商品有不同的促销活动 满减:满200减 ...
- Salesforce学习之路(七)Visualforce结合Reports展示图表
Salesforce作为一款CRM系统,个人觉得最重要的环境便是在于数据的展示和联动,而Salesforce也本身提供了相当强大的功能,Report在展示图表的方面十分强大,前段时间更是宣布以157亿 ...
- PowerBI 使用Bookmark
使用PowerBI Desktop中的bookmark(书签),开发人员可以捕获报表中一个页面的当前配置,包括过滤器的设置,Visual的状态等信息,此后,开发人员可以通过激活已保存的bookmark ...
- OO_UNIT4_SUMMARY
经过一个学期的学习,OO课程终于落下帷幕.本次博客会首先对第四单元作业的架构进行分析,再对OO课程进行总体回顾,最后是个人的建议与体会. 一.第四单元三次作业架构设计 1.第一次作业 第一次作业是对类 ...
- 【SpringBoot】SpringBoot集成jasypt数据库密码加密
一.为什么要使用jasypt库? 目前springboot单体应用项目中,甚至没有使用外部配置中心的多服务的微服务架构的项目,开发/测试/生产环境中的密码往往是明文配置在yml或properties文 ...
- DVWA之DOM XSS(DOM型跨站脚本攻击)
目录 Low Medium High Impossible Low 源代码: <?php # No protections, anything goes ?> 从源代码可以看出,这里low ...
- 板载网卡MAC地址丢失后刷回方法[转]
部份客户在进行误操作后发现网卡MAC地址全部变成0,大部客户不知道如何重新将MAC地址写回去.就此问题我们介绍一下,希望可以帮到大家.修改MAC地址时,一定要在纯DOS环境下修改.目前使用U盘DOS引 ...
- 【python】Leetcode每日一题-设计停车系统
[python]Leetcode每日一题-设计停车系统 [题目描述] 请你给一个停车场设计一个停车系统.停车场总共有三种不同大小的车位:大,中和小,每种尺寸分别有固定数目的车位. 请你实现 Parki ...
- C# 多线程技术
这节讲一下多线程(Thread)技术. 在讲线程之前,先区分一下程序,进程,线程三者的区别,大体上说,一个程序可以分为多个进程,一个进程至少由一个线程去执行,它们是层层包含的关系.我们写的程序,就是一 ...